Kako odstraniti zaščito Excelovih delovnih zvezkov

Kazalo:

Kako odstraniti zaščito Excelovih delovnih zvezkov
Kako odstraniti zaščito Excelovih delovnih zvezkov
Anonim

Kaj morate vedeti

  • Odstrani zaščito kot lastnik: odprite preglednico. Izberite Pregled > Odstrani zaščito lista. Vnesite geslo za zaščito datoteke. Izberite OK.
  • Odstrani zaščito brez gesla: Odprite preglednico. Odprite Visual Basic urejevalnik kode tako, da izberete Developer > Ogled kode.
  • Nato vnesite kodo iz tega članka in izberite Zaženi. V nekaj minutah se razkrije geslo. Izberite OK.

Ta članek pojasnjuje, kako odstraniti zaščito Excelovih delovnih zvezkov kot lastnik delovnega zvezka z geslom ali kot posameznik brez gesla. Te informacije veljajo za Excelove delovne zvezke v Microsoft Excel 365, Microsoft Excel 2019, 2016 in 2013.

Kako odkleniti Excelov delovni zvezek kot lastnik

Microsoft Excel je poln funkcij. Ena takšnih funkcij je možnost zaščite vaših Excelovih datotek na ravni celice, preglednice ali delovnega zvezka. Včasih je treba odstraniti zaščito Excelovih delovnih zvezkov, da se zagotovi pravilna uporaba sprememb podatkov.

Ta metoda predvideva, da se kot lastnik datoteke spomnite gesla, uporabljenega za zaščito preglednice.

  1. Odprite zaščiteno preglednico in izberite Pregled > Odstrani zaščito lista. Prav tako lahko z desno miškino tipko kliknete zaščiteno preglednico in izberete Odstrani zaščito lista.

    Zaščiteno preglednico lahko prepoznate v razdelku Spremembe zavihka Pregled na traku. Če je preglednica zaščitena, vidite možnost Odstrani zaščito lista.

    Image
    Image
  2. Vnesite geslo za zaščito preglednice, nato izberite OK.

    Image
    Image
  3. Vaša preglednica bo zdaj nezaščitena in jo lahko spreminjate.

    Image
    Image

Kako odstraniti zaščito Excelovega delovnega zvezka, ne da bi vedeli geslo

Morda ste zaščitili svoj Excelov delovni zvezek ali preglednico in vam ga že nekaj časa, celo leta, ni bilo treba spreminjati. Zdaj, ko morate narediti spremembe, se ne spomnite več gesla, ki ste ga uporabili za zaščito te preglednice.

Na srečo vam bodo ti koraki omogočili, da odstranite zaščito svojega delovnega zvezka z uporabo skripta Virtual Basic kot makra za prepoznavanje gesla.

  1. Odprite zaščiteno preglednico.
  2. Dostopite do urejevalnika kod Visual Basic tako, da pritisnete ALT+F11 ali izberete Developer > Ogled kode.

    Image
    Image
  3. V oknu Koda zaščitenega lista vnesite naslednjo kodo:

    Sub PasswordBreaker()

    Dim i As Integer, j Kot Integer, k Kot Integer

    Dim l As Integer, m Kot Integer, n Kot Integer

    Dim i1 As Integer, i2 As Integer, i3 As Integer

    Dim i4 As Integer, i5 As Integer, i6 As Integer

    On Error Resume Next

    For i=65 To 66: For j=65 do 66: za k=65 do 66

    za l=65 do 66: za m=65 do 66: za i1=65 do 66

    za i2=65 do 66: za i3=65 do 66: za i4=65 do 66

    za i5=65 do 66: za i6=65 do 66: za n=32 do 126

    ActiveSheet. Unprotect Chr(i) & Chr (j) & Chr(k) & _

    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& Chr(i3) & _

    Chr(i4) & Chr(i5) & Chr(i6) & Chr(n)

    If ActiveSheet. ProtectContents=False Then

    MsgBox "Eno uporabno geslo je " & Chr(i) & Chr(j) & _

    Chr(k) & Chr(l) & Chr(m) & Chr(i1) & Chr(i2) & _

    Chr(i3) & Chr(i4) & Chr(i5)) & Chr(i6) & Chr(n)

    Exit Sub

    End If

    Next: Next: Next: Next: Next: Next

    Next: Next: Naslednji: Naslednji: Naslednji: Naslednji

    End Sub

    Image
    Image
  4. Izberite Zaženi ali pritisnite F5 za izvedbo kode.

    Image
    Image
  5. Zagon kode bo trajal nekaj minut. Ko končate, boste prejeli pojavno okno z geslom. Izberite OK in vaša preglednica bo nezaščitena.

    To ni izvirno geslo in si ga ni treba zapomniti.

Priporočena: